A groin hernia develops along the skin crease where the leg meets the abdomen, when part of an internal organ or tissue bulges through the abdominal wall. The Triarchic Theory of Intelligence, formulated by Robert Sternberg, is a cognitive-contextual theory that states three forms of intelligence: practical, creative, and analytical intelligence. 6.
